Why are grasshoppers so big?

Grasshoppers are not particularly big. The average size of a grasshopper is between 1 and 2 inches long. Some species of grasshoppers, such as the lubber grasshopper, can grow to be up to 3 inches long. However, these large grasshoppers are relatively rare.
